Auto dealerships supply a series of solutions connected to the purchasing and marketing of automobiles. One of their primary functions is to function as middlemans (or intermediaries) in between cars and truck manufacturers and clients, buying lorries directly from the supplier and afterwards selling them to consumers at a markup. On top of that, they frequently supply financing alternatives for customers and will certainly assist with the trade-in or sale of a client's old vehicle.
